Default Defending your Blinds

Absolute 0.50 NL, 9 handed
Villain is SB with ~$70
Hero is BB with ~$100 and 2[img]/images/graemlins/diamond.gif[/img] J[img]/images/graemlins/diamond.gif[/img]

7 folds, villain raises to $1.25, Hero reraises to $4

No reads on villain, just that this looks like a blind steal. If it is i think this raise, followed by a bet/raise on any flop if called is +EV with any 2. It's also possible i've been playing too many tournaments lately... thoughts?
